Why Safety Certification Comes First in Work Boots
Before getting into design preferences for work boots, it helps to understand what safety certification actually means in practical terms. In the United States, OSHA's 29 CFR 1910.136 requires employers to provide protective work boots meeting ASTM F2413 standards for workers exposed to foot injury risks from impacts, punctures, or electrical hazards. This is not optional; it is a compliance requirement.
Under ASTM F2413, certified certified safety toe boots must retain at least a 0.5-inch clearance after a 75 foot-pounds (101.7 joules) impact and withstand a compression force of 2,500 lbs (11,121 N). If your workplace falls under OSHA jurisdiction, these are the minimum specs you need to verify in your work boots before any other consideration.
In European and international markets, EN ISO 20345 is the applicable standard for safety footwear. It requires a basic safety toe protection rated at 200 joules of impact energy, with a range of optional protection classes covering slip resistance (SRA, SRB, SRC ratings), electrical hazard protection, waterproofing, and heat or cold resistance.

Key Safety Features to Evaluate in Work Boots
Once you have confirmed which standard applies to your situation, here are the core safety features to assess:
- Toe protection: Steel toe options are the traditional choice, offering proven impact and compression resistance. Composite toe boots (made from materials such as fiberglass or carbon fiber) provide equivalent certified protection at a lighter weight. If your work involves long hours of walking or standing, lighter options can make a noticeable difference in fatigue levels. In environments with metal detectors, composite toe boots are also the practical choice.
- Slip resistance: Look for SRC-rated outsoles if your work surface involves wet, oily, or polished floors. SRC represents the highest combined slip resistance rating under EN ISO 20345, covering both ceramic tile with soapy water (SRA) and smooth steel with glycerol (SRB) test surfaces.
- Waterproofing: Waterproof boots are rated under controlled test conditions. In practice, long-duration exposure or deep submersion will eventually exceed those limits. If you regularly work in wet conditions, confirm the waterproofing grade rather than relying on labeling alone.
- Ankle support and height: High-ankle styles provide better lateral stability on uneven terrain: construction sites, outdoor jobsites, and environments with irregular surfaces. Low-cut styles offer more flexibility and are better suited to flat indoor environments where mobility matters more.
- Electrical hazard protection: If your work involves live circuits or electrical equipment, look for boots rated to ASTM F2413 EH (electrical hazard) or equivalent standards. These are designed to reduce the risk of electric shock from contact with live conductors under dry conditions.
- Puncture resistance: For construction, demolition, or outdoor industrial work where sharp debris is a common hazard, boots with a midsole rated to ASTM F2413 PR (puncture resistant) add a meaningful layer of protection.
Where Style Has Room in Work Boots
After confirming that work boots meet the safety requirements for your specific environment, you have real latitude to prioritize aesthetics, and that space is larger than it used to be.
Work boots design has shifted noticeably over the past decade. The old assumption that certified work boots must look industrial or bulky no longer holds. Many modern work boots combine full safety certification with cleaner silhouettes, leather upper options, and profile designs close enough to dress boots or casual footwear to transition between the jobsite and a client meeting without standing out.
Style dimensions worth considering when selecting work boots:
- Upper material: Full-grain leather work boots are more durable and develop a better appearance over time compared to synthetic alternatives. If professional appearance matters in your workplace, leather work boots are worth the premium. For purely functional environments, synthetic work boots are lighter and often more water-resistant out of the box.
- Boot height and silhouette: Classic 6-inch work boots hit just above the ankle and remain the most versatile option—appropriate in most industries and workplace settings. 8-inch and taller work boots offer more ankle protection and a more industrial look. Low-cut work boots or 4-inch styles lean closer to casual footwear aesthetics and suit lighter-duty environments.
- Color: Black and brown remain the standard colors for most work boots used in professional and construction environments. Some industries have specific conventions—food processing facilities often require white or light-colored work boots for hygiene visibility reasons.
- Lacing systems: Traditional lacing is most common in work boots, but some designs use side-zip or pull-on systems that read as cleaner and more contemporary. These work boots also have practical advantages in high-frequency on-off environments.
Matching Work Boots to Your Industry
There is no single right choice in work boots: the right pair depends on what you are actually doing. Using one pair of work boots across all conditions simplifies procurement, but in environments with specific hazard profiles, purpose-built work boots usually deliver better results than a general-purpose option.
For construction and heavy industry, the priority is maximum protection: steel or composite toe work boots with puncture-resistant midsole, high ankle, and an SRC-rated outsole. For manufacturing or logistics environments where workers are on their feet all day, comfort factors in work boots (cushioned insoles, ergonomic midsoles, lighter overall weight) matter as much as protection ratings. For trades workers who interact with clients and also spend time in office settings, a cleaner leather work boots design in a lower-profile style is a reasonable choice, provided the protection rating still meets site requirements.
A Practical Checklist Before You Buy Work Boots
If you want a simple framework for evaluating work boots before committing:
- Identify the applicable safety standard for your market (ASTM F2413 for North America; EN ISO 20345 for Europe and international markets) and confirm your work boots meet it.
- List the specific hazards in your environment (impact, puncture, slip, electrical, temperature) and verify the work boots' protection classes cover each one.
- Check the fit: properly fitting work boots should have approximately a thumb's width of space at the toe and feel snug but not tight across the widest part of the foot. Fit affects not just comfort in work boots but also how well protective features function.
- Consider the work boots height relative to your terrain and ankle support needs.
- Within work boots that meet all the above criteria, compare aesthetics (upper material, profile, color) based on what your workplace environment actually requires.
The frame to carry forward: safety certification establishes the non-negotiable baseline for all work boots; style is where you make the choice that works for your specific context. Both matter—but in that order.
